Calculate the noon sun angles for new orleans, usa and helsinki, finland on september 22. in the answer below, new orleans answe
Otrada [13]
<span>We need to calculate noon sun angle. Noon sun angle is an angle at which sun-rays fall at noon on a given date.
</span>On September 22, the sun’s rays form a 90° angle at noon at the equator.

Formula for calculating noon sun angle is:

Noon_sun_angle = 90° - Zenith angle

We have complementary angles so we need to substract zenith angle from 90°.

The zenith angle is the distance between subsolar point (point where sun is at 90°) and the latitude of an observer. In our case this angle will have same value as latitude because subsolar point is at equator 0°. If our latitude and subsolar point are at same hemisphere we substract values. Otherwise we add values.

New Orleans, USA
Latitude = 30°
Noon_sun_angle = 90° - 30° = 60°

Helsinki, Finland
Latitude = 60°
Noon_sun_angle = 90° - 60° = 30°

Write the equation for the line in slope intercept form ​
Helen [10]

Answer:

  y = -2x -3

Step-by-step explanation:

The line crosses the y-axis at -3, so that is the y-intercept.

It has a "rise" of -2 units for each "run" of 1 unit, so the slope is -2. (For example, from point (-1, -1) to point (0, -3).)

The slope m and y-intercept b are used in the slope-intercept form of the equation of a line:

   y = mx + b

For the values this line has, the equation is ...

   y = -2x -3
